The aim of the discipline is to provide students with the main knowledge concerning the regulatory mechanisms that characterize the different cell lines during differentiation into specialized tissue components and the main cytochemical and histochemical methods applied to them.

Mechanisms of cell tissue differentiation with particular attention to the hematopoietic population - Immunological polarization - Stem cells -
- Main applied cytochemical and histochemical methods
- NERVOUS TISSUE: cell population and differentiation
-EPITHELIAL TISSUE: cell population and differentiation
- LYMPHOID TISSUE: cell population and differentiation
- BONE TISSUES: cell population and differentiation
- HEMOPOIETIC SYSTEM - MAIN HEMOPOIETIC ORGANS: cell population and differentiation
